#5dbcec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5dbcec is composed of 36.5% red, 73.7%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.6% cyan, 20.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 200.1 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 64.5%. #5dbcec color hex could be obtained by blending #baffff with #0079d9.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#5dbcec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5dbcec has RGB values of R:93, G:188,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 6143212.

Shades and Tints of #5dbcec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a0e is the darkest color, while #fbfdff is the lightest one.
